When it comes to designing fonts, you need to select the base font, specify its style and size, then start adjusting its look. Once you are satisfied with the result, you can export it to BMP, JPEG, PNG, PPM, TIFF, XBM or XPM and integrate it within the source code of your app. ![]() You can flip, rotate or shift the image with a few mouse clicks, or inverse it. When designing icons, you can either settle for the default size or you can adjust it to meet your needs - and the same goes for the colors you can integrate within the graphic file. If you decide to start working from scratch, you need to specify whether you are interested in creating an icon or a font. The graphic interface of LCD Image Converter is intuitive and you can easily start working on a new project or resume an existing one. The software utility does not require any installation so you can carry it on your portable USB drive and run it whenever you have some spare time. You you want to modify the images used within your source code, you need to rely on templates, which means that when you change the templates, you can also modify the output within certain limits. Whenever you want to customize the look of your embedded applications, you could try designing a new icon or even a new font and LCD Image Converter is the type of app that can help you.
